Manxie (he grew up here, we’re claiming him) Bevan Rodd has been named in England’s 33 man squad for the men’s Rugby World Cup.

The Sale Sharks man had looked set to miss out last month but has been named in Steve Borthwick’s team this morning.

One of 19 forwards picked, Rodd comes into the squad off the back of a decent season with Sale, which saw them reach the final of the Premiership, where they lost out to Saracens.

The 2023 Rugby World Cup will be taking place in France from 8 September to 28 October, with England’s first game at 98pm on September 9 against Argentina.
